boost gauge and coolant tmp. gauge not working
 
My stock boost gauge and engine temp gauge dont work!!! when i turn the car on they dont even move they are just dead. sometimes when i have the lights on the dash lights turn off. what gives?

The water temp gauge and the boost gauge are fed independently. No common fuse b/t them.

So pull the gauge cluster off and ring the wires out from the cluster to the unit your interested in.

I'd start with the boost gauge. It shares the output wire of the boost/pressure sensor wtih the ECU. No signal to the ECU could spell curtains for your engine some day. Free fsm available online with schematics.
